It says &quot;coroner's unit, robbery unit,&quot; with a handwritten note: call me please. That's how my guest Mandi Pratt found out, a year after leaving an abusive marriage, that the FBI had been hunting her ex-husband for six to nine months, for a string of bank robberies. If you've ever wondered how to trust your intuition after trauma, when your own mind has been trained to doubt itself, this is the episode that shows you how, from someone whose story was on the news twice. Mandi transformed that plot twist into a framework for self-leadership and resilience, and now helps individuals and organizations understand how stress and survival responses affect decision-making, boundaries, and wellbeing. We get into what &quot;survival mode&quot; actually looks like when you're a single mom of a toddler with a criminal case unfolding around you, why validation (not advice) is what actually cuts the risk of complex PTSD, and Mandi's simple &quot;happy list,&quot; a menu of go-to things that help her regulate when she can't think straight enough to help herself. Twenty years out, Mandi is remarried, her son is grown, and she's still learning what it means for a nervous system to finally feel safe enough to rest.
